Forgings for One of the Gulf's Earliest and Most Diversified Industrial Economies
Bahrain holds a historically distinctive position in the Gulf region as the site of the area's first commercial oil discovery, and while its own hydrocarbon reserves are modest compared to its larger neighbors, the country built one of the earliest and most diversified industrial and financial economies in the Gulf as a direct result of that early start. This diversification is visible today across several genuinely substantial industrial pillars.
Bahrain is home to one of the largest aluminium smelting operations in the world, a major anchor of the country's industrial base that has, over decades, drawn in a substantial downstream aluminium processing and fabrication industry requiring forged alloy steel and stainless structural and equipment component blanks. Alongside aluminium, Bahrain's petrochemical and oil refining industry requires forged flange, valve body, and pressure-retaining component blanks in carbon and alloy steel to ASTM/ASME specifications, while the country's broader general industrial and trading economy sources forged components for equipment manufacturing, maintenance, and fabrication applications.
Manama functions as one of the Gulf's most established international banking and financial services centers, and this financial sophistication extends into well-developed port and logistics infrastructure supporting the country's industrial base. Ocean freight from Indian ports such as Mundra or Nhava Sheva to Bahrain typically transits in the range of two to three weeks given the relatively direct Arabian Sea and Gulf routing, with shipments routing to Khalifa Bin Salman Port and onward road delivery across the country's compact industrial geography.
